In English, this translates to:

"The number 2.3×1042.3 \times 10^{-4} when written in standard form is..."

To convert this scientific notation to standard form:

2.3×104=0.000232.3 \times 10^{-4} = 0.00023

Thus, the number in standard form is 0.00023.
